Macquarie Group traditionally makes two partially-franked dividend payments to shareholders annually in July and December.
-
Yes, Macquarie Group offers a dividend reinvestment plan (DRP) as an alternative to receiving cash dividends on Macquarie Group ordinary shares.
-
Macquarie Group listed on the ASX on 5 November 2007.

About Macquarie Group Limited
Macquarie Group Ltd (ASX: MQG) provides banking, financial, advisory, investment, and fund management services across 34 markets globally.
Macquarie is one of the largest companies trading on the ASX and Australia’s fifth-largest bank by market capitalisation, but its retail banking services make up just a small percentage of its business. The bank is primarily involved in investment and commercial banking and asset management, with Macquarie now in the top 50 global asset managers.
Founded in 1969 and first listed on the ASX in 2007, Macquarie has specialist investment and asset management expertise in areas such as resources, agriculture and commodities, energy and infrastructure.
